Transaction 4636fae3b3ec628379f619a310eed9697acc2533987abff0ae05f4a61debaa32

101 Input
2 Outputs
  • 4636fae3b3ec628379f619a310eed9697acc2533987abff0ae05f4a61debaa32:0
  • value  100000000
    address  n2U66b9WQjcAZMHd1D7wtFS2R9Wwu9wVYf
  • 4636fae3b3ec628379f619a310eed9697acc2533987abff0ae05f4a61debaa32:1
  • value  298761
    address  mgRW5ZwAe38YsyLXfFvqCYA15FabbPh6Jh